The National Weather Service in Huntsville has issued a Winter Weather Advisory for Lauderdale and Limestone counties.
It's in effect through 9 a.m. Thursday and also includes Lincoln and Moore counties in Tennessee.
WHAT...Freezing rain with additional ice accumulations of a light glaze.
WHERE...In Alabama, Lauderdale and Limestone counties. In Tennessee, Moore and Lincoln counties.
WHEN...Until 9 AM CST Thursday.
IMPACTS...Very slippery sidewalks, roads and bridges are possible. The hazardous conditions could impact the morning or evening commute.
P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...
Slow down and use caution while traveling. Prepare for possible power outages.
